BAE Systems is showcasing its new situational awareness tool, Battleview 360, for land vehicles at DSEI in London.
The system is on display on the CV90 tracked vehicle and is part of a larger future development initiative of the infantry fighting vehicle.
The system uses technology similar that used in fighter jets to create a situational awareness system which allows vehicle crews to theoretically ‘see through’ their vehicles in real time.
Battleview 360 is a digital mapping system that collates, displays and tracks the position of surrounding features of interest in 2D or 3D mode.
